2核4G配置的服务器安装宝塔后还能流畅运行网站吗?

2核4G的服务器在安装宝塔面板后可以流畅运行中小型网站(如企业官网、博客、小型电商、WordPress、Discuz! 等),但是否“流畅”取决于具体使用场景、优化程度和并发访问量。以下是详细分析:

优势与可行性(为什么可以):

  • ✅ 宝塔面板本身资源占用较低:
    • 启动后常驻进程(bt、nginx/apache、mysql、php-fpm、pure-ftpd 等)在空闲时通常仅占用 300–600MB 内存(取决于所选软件栈),CPU 占用 <5%。
    • 4GB 内存足以支撑 Nginx + MySQL 5.7/8.0 + PHP 7.4/8.1 + Redis(可选)的轻量组合。
  • ✅ 2核CPU满足日常请求处理:
    • 静态页面、PHP动态页(非高计算型)、数据库查询较简单的场景下,QPS 50–150+ 是可行的(经合理优化)。
  • ✅ 宝塔提供一键优化工具:
    • 如「网站监控」、「PHP OPcache 开启」、「MySQL 性能调优向导」、「Nginx 缓存配置」等,可显著提升响应速度。
⚠️ 关键限制与注意事项(需规避风险): 风险点 说明 建议
未优化的 WordPress/大型CMS 默认安装+大量插件+无缓存 → 内存爆满、MySQL频繁OOM ✅ 必开OPcache + Redis对象缓存 + Nginx FastCGI缓存;禁用冗余插件;选用轻量主题
高并发突发流量(如被攻击/爆款文章) 100+并发连接可能耗尽内存或触发MySQL崩溃 ✅ 启用宝塔防火墙 + Cloudflare(免费版);设置PHP最大子进程数(如 pm.max_children = 20);开启连接超时与限速
运行多个高负载服务 如同时跑Node.js应用、Java后台、视频转码、爬虫等 ❌ 不推荐!2核4G不适合多服务混部;建议单一用途(专注Web)
MySQL默认配置(尤其大表) innodb_buffer_pool_size 默认128MB → 大于10万行的表易慢查 ✅ 宝塔→数据库→性能调优→将该值设为 1.5–2GB(占内存40–50%)

实测参考(典型场景):

  • ✅ 企业官网(HTML/静态+少量PHP):常年 CPU <5%,内存 1.2GB,完全无压力;
  • ✅ WordPress博客(日均PV 3000,含WP Super Cache + Redis):平均响应 <300ms,内存稳定在2.1GB;
  • ✅ 小型商城(基于ShopXO/ThinkPHP,商品<500,订单日均<50):配合OPcache+Redis,可承载短时200并发。

🔧 必做优化清单(让2核4G真正“流畅”):

  1. 系统层:关闭不用的服务(如 vsftpd 改用宝塔SFTP)、禁用IPv6(若不用);
  2. Web层:Nginx 开启 Gzip + Brotli(宝塔支持)、启用 fastcgi_cacheproxy_cache
  3. PHP层:选择 PHP 8.1+(性能更好),开启 OPcache 并调优(opcache.memory_consumption=128);
  4. 数据库:MySQL 8.0+,innodb_buffer_pool_size=1800M,禁用查询日志(log_bin, general_log);
  5. 安全防护:宝塔防火墙 + 设置防CC规则(如单IP 1分钟请求>60次拦截);
  6. 监控预警:宝塔内置监控 + 微信告警(内存 >90% / CPU >95% 持续5分钟即通知)。

📌 结论:

2核4G + 宝塔 = 完全胜任中小型生产网站,且体验流畅(前提是合理选型、规范部署、必要优化)。它不是“玩具配置”,而是国内中小企业和开发者最主流的入门级生产环境之一。
若未来流量持续增长(如月PV >50万 或 日订单 >500),再平滑升级至4核8G即可,无需重构。

需要的话,我可以为你提供:

  • ✅ 一份针对2核4G优化的 my.cnfphp.ini 参数模板
  • ✅ 宝塔下 WordPress 全链路提速配置指南(含Redis缓存设置截图逻辑)
  • ✅ 命令行一键检测当前瓶颈的脚本(查内存/CPU/慢SQL/连接数)

欢迎继续提问 😊

未经允许不得转载:CLOUD云枢 » 2核4G配置的服务器安装宝塔后还能流畅运行网站吗?